.ReinforcementLearningDemo_container__LsKuT{display:flex;flex-direction:column;align-items:center;gap:2rem;padding:2rem;background:rgba(0,0,0,.8);border-radius:1rem;backdrop-filter:blur(10px);border:1px solid rgba(0,255,255,.2);box-shadow:0 0 20px rgba(0,255,255,.1);width:100%;max-width:800px;margin:0 auto}.ReinforcementLearningDemo_grid__g7E5h{display:grid;grid-template-columns:repeat(5,1fr);gap:.5rem;background:rgba(0,0,0,.3);padding:1rem;border-radius:.5rem;box-shadow:inset 0 0 10px rgba(0,0,0,.5);border:1px solid hsla(0,0%,100%,.05);width:100%;max-width:500px}.ReinforcementLearningDemo_cell__Cmkjn{width:100%;aspect-ratio:1/1;display:flex;align-items:center;justify-content:center;font-size:1.5rem;border-radius:.25rem;transition:all .3s ease;position:relative;overflow:hidden;border:1px solid hsla(0,0%,100%,.05)}.ReinforcementLearningDemo_cell__Cmkjn:before{content:"";position:absolute;top:0;left:0;width:100%;height:100%;background:linear-gradient(135deg,hsla(0,0%,100%,.05),transparent);pointer-events:none}.ReinforcementLearningDemo_agent__MowB5{background:rgba(0,255,255,.2);box-shadow:0 0 15px rgba(0,255,255,.7);animation:ReinforcementLearningDemo_pulse__bFYIq 1.5s infinite alternate;z-index:10}.ReinforcementLearningDemo_target__H9hwr{background:rgba(255,255,0,.2);box-shadow:0 0 15px rgba(255,255,0,.7);animation:ReinforcementLearningDemo_glow__XMcrE 2s infinite alternate}.ReinforcementLearningDemo_obstacle__3WhAV{background:rgba(255,0,0,.2);box-shadow:0 0 15px rgba(255,0,0,.5)}.ReinforcementLearningDemo_empty__WFhn4{background:hsla(0,0%,100%,.03);transition:all .5s ease}.ReinforcementLearningDemo_empty__WFhn4:hover{background:hsla(0,0%,100%,.1)}.ReinforcementLearningDemo_controls__m1d6m{display:flex;flex-direction:column;gap:1rem;width:100%;max-width:500px}.ReinforcementLearningDemo_buttons__9pzLU{display:flex;gap:.5rem;flex-wrap:wrap;justify-content:space-between}.ReinforcementLearningDemo_button__BRS6G{padding:.75rem 1.5rem;border:none;border-radius:.5rem;background:rgba(0,255,255,.2);color:#0ff;font-weight:500;cursor:pointer;transition:all .2s ease;position:relative;overflow:hidden;text-transform:uppercase;letter-spacing:1px;border:1px solid rgba(0,255,255,.3);flex:1;min-width:120px}.ReinforcementLearningDemo_button__BRS6G:hover{background:rgba(0,255,255,.3);transform:translateY(-2px);box-shadow:0 5px 15px rgba(0,0,0,.3)}.ReinforcementLearningDemo_button__BRS6G:active{transform:translateY(0)}.ReinforcementLearningDemo_stats__XO4YD{display:flex;justify-content:space-between;padding:1rem;background:rgba(0,0,0,.3);border-radius:.5rem;border:1px solid hsla(0,0%,100%,.05);color:#0ff;font-weight:500}.ReinforcementLearningDemo_parameters__6RNdo{display:flex;flex-direction:column;gap:1rem;color:hsla(0,0%,100%,.8)}.ReinforcementLearningDemo_parameters__6RNdo label{display:flex;flex-direction:column;gap:.5rem}.ReinforcementLearningDemo_parameters__6RNdo input[type=range]{width:100%;height:.5rem;background:rgba(0,0,0,.3);border-radius:.25rem;outline:none;-webkit-appearance:none;border:1px solid rgba(0,255,255,.3)}.ReinforcementLearningDemo_parameters__6RNdo input[type=range]::-webkit-slider-thumb{-webkit-appearance:none;width:1rem;height:1rem;background:#0ff;border-radius:50%;cursor:pointer;transition:all .2s ease;box-shadow:0 0 10px rgba(0,255,255,.7)}.ReinforcementLearningDemo_parameters__6RNdo input[type=range]::-webkit-slider-thumb:hover{transform:scale(1.2)}.ReinforcementLearningDemo_performanceSection__KRkDE{margin-top:1.5rem;width:100%;border-top:1px solid rgba(0,255,255,.2);padding-top:1.5rem}@keyframes ReinforcementLearningDemo_pulse__bFYIq{0%{box-shadow:0 0 10px rgba(0,255,255,.5)}to{box-shadow:0 0 20px rgba(0,255,255,.9)}}@keyframes ReinforcementLearningDemo_glow__XMcrE{0%{box-shadow:0 0 10px rgba(255,255,0,.5)}to{box-shadow:0 0 20px rgba(255,255,0,.9)}}@media (max-width:768px){.ReinforcementLearningDemo_container__LsKuT{padding:1rem}.ReinforcementLearningDemo_buttons__9pzLU{flex-direction:column}.ReinforcementLearningDemo_button__BRS6G{width:100%}}